Themes Generative Artificial Intelligence ETF (WISE) aims to provide investors exposure to companies involved in AI-related industries. The fund invests primarily in securities that comprise its underlying index, including American and Global Depositary Receipts.

What Does WISE Do?

Themes Generative Artificial Intelligence ETF (WISE) is designed to offer investors targeted exposure to the burgeoning field of artificial intelligence. The fund operates by tracking an index composed of companies actively engaged in AI-related industries. WISE allocates at least 80% of its net assets, along with any borrowings for investment purposes, into the securities that constitute the index. This includes investments in American Depositary Receipts (ADRs) and Global Depositary Receipts (GDRs) that represent the securities within the index, providing a global perspective on AI investments. As a non-diversified fund, WISE concentrates its investments in a relatively small number of AI-focused companies, which can lead to higher volatility compared to more diversified ETFs. The fund's objective is to closely mirror the performance of its underlying index, allowing investors to gain exposure to the potential growth and innovation within the AI sector.
